Abuse Services — Agency budget review by OMES. In addition to other duties imposed upon the Office of Management and Enterprise Services (OMES) by law, the Director of the Office of Management and Enterprise Services shall ensure that the following procedures are strictly adhered to with respect to the Oklahoma Department of Mental Health and Substance Abuse Services: 1. In accordance with paragraph 3 of subsection A of Section 34.6 of this title, prior to releasing the one-twelfth (1/12) appropriations disbursement, OMES shall conduct a review of the agency's budget to actuals to ensure the agency is staying within budget constraints; 2.
